G. Scott Erickson is a scholar working on Communication, Sociology and Political Science and Information Systems and Management. According to data from OpenAlex, G. Scott Erickson has authored 12 papers receiving a total of 216 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 6 papers in Communication, 4 papers in Sociology and Political Science and 4 papers in Information Systems and Management. Recurrent topics in G. Scott Erickson’s work include Knowledge Management and Sharing (5 papers), Technology Adoption and User Behaviour (4 papers) and Intellectual Capital and Performance Analysis (3 papers). G. Scott Erickson is often cited by papers focused on Knowledge Management and Sharing (5 papers), Technology Adoption and User Behaviour (4 papers) and Intellectual Capital and Performance Analysis (3 papers). G. Scott Erickson collaborates with scholars based in United States and Poland. G. Scott Erickson's co-authors include Eileen P. Kelly, Wioleta Kucharska, Robert D. Miller and Jack K. Odum and has published in prestigious journals such as International Journal of Information Management, Industrial Management & Data Systems and Journal of Marketing Management.
